Q: What causes sewer backups?
A: Sewer backups can be caused by a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, aging infrastructure, and tree roots growing into sewer lines. Q: Can I prevent sewer backups?
A: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ent sewer backups, including regular maintenance of your plumbing system, avoiding flushing non-biodegradable items, and installing a backwater valve.
